The Special Department for Combating Corruption of the Higher Public Prosecutor’s Office in Belgrade has launched an investigation into a tragic incident that occurred Thursday evening at the Faculty of Philosophy, when the body of a young woman was found on the plateau in front of the building.

The Ministry of the Interior (MUP) stated that at around 10:40 p.m. on Thursday, following the activation and ignition of pyrotechnic devices on the fifth floor of the faculty, a 25-year-old woman allegedly jumped from a window and died.
The head of the Stari Grad Police Station, Radenko Resanovic, said that police officers received the report at 10:40 p.m., after which they immediately arrived at the scene, where they found the woman showing no signs of life.

"According to initial information obtained from eyewitnesses, pyrotechnic devices were activated and ignited on the fifth floor of the Faculty of Philosophy, after which, as is suspected, a female person - most likely a student of the faculty - jumped through a window," Resanovic said, according to a statement from the Ministry of the Interior.
As stated, the police were instructed to enter the Faculty of Philosophy building due to threats to public safety, life, physical integrity, health, and property, and to promptly examine all circumstances related to the incident.
